Feb 15, 2024 · B1 Level (Intermediate): 300-360 hours. B2 Level (Upper-Intermediate): 540-620 hours. According to the CEFR, conversational fluency emerges at the B2 level after dedicating 540-620 hours of intentional practice. This milestone is achievable in 12-24 months through consistent habits. Oct 14, 2023 · Studying Spanish for 6 hours a week, 1 hour a day, would take about 2 years to reach 600 hours. Cut that time in half to 30 minutes a day, 6 days a week, and it will take you about 4 years. Double that time to two hours a day with a complete immersion program, and it will take you about a year. Por (for) is the same in both Spanish & Portuguese, especially with its use compared to para, but if “the” follows it in Spanish, you just add el or la. In Portuguese the word itself changes entirely. “Por el” –> Pelo, “Por la” –> Pela ( never por a / por o, as it would be in Portuguese word-for-word).If you’re serious about investing in learning Spanish, you might consider enrolling in an online college Spanish class or possibly pursuing a Spanish degree. …Jan 3, 2024 · The Rosetta Stone Spanish program is built around 20 learning units, with each being made up of four lessons.
